New Showbiz Analysis

Lumina is a genre-driven thriller that emphasizes suspense and psychological instability over diverse representation. While it uses familiar sci-fi clichés, it offers a unique perspective on institutional distrust through the protagonist's immersion in conspiracy theories. The narrative highlights the protagonist's descent into fringe belief systems as a reaction to systemic failures and government opacity. However, the reliance on traditional romantic frameworks and a lack of diverse casting prevent it from achieving a higher score in systemic representation.

Does Lumina have LGBTQ+ representation?

Limited

The story focuses on traditional romantic tensions between Alex, Tatiana, and Delilah. There is no clear depiction of non-straight relationships or narratives that question the assumption that everyone is straight.

How does Lumina portray gender?

Fair

Women such as Patricia and Delilah have moments where they play significant roles in driving the story, but the plot is mainly centered around Alex's psychological journey.

How racially and ethnically diverse is Lumina?

Limited

The film features a traditional Western cast with no clear evidence of a non-white majority cast or intentional use of actors from different backgrounds to challenge the status quo.

How does Lumina represent religion and culture?

Good

The movie explores skepticism towards established institutions and official authorities. It portrays government inaction and the breakdown of trust through the protagonist's involvement in conspiracy theories.

Does Lumina include disability representation?

Minimal

There is no evidence of characters with visible or invisible disabilities. The film does not explore neurodivergence or mental health issues through a lens of empowerment.

Official Synopsis

When the sudden appearance of lights from the sky causes his girlfriend to disappear, Alex and his friends embark on a quest to find her. Their journey soon leads them to a deep underground military base where they encounter government agents and an alien menace that threatens their lives.
